A fantastic morning at Joseph Rowntree School

Thu 22 Aug, 2019 @ 9.58 am News YorkMix

Jumping for joy at Jo Ro
No wonder they’re looking so happy at Joseph Rowntree School.

Nineteen of their students got six or more GCSEs at grade 7 or higher, over 10% achieved grades 7-9 in English and Maths and 71% of all grades are at grade 4 or above.

Altogether 66% of students gained a grade 4 or higher in English and Maths and Science results are very strong. There has also been a strong performance in the EBacc subjects of Geography and History.

Headteacher Dave Hewitt said:

  • It has been a fantastic morning at Joseph Rowntree School with students being delighted with their GCSE and BTEC results.

    There are lots of individual success stories and we are looking forward to welcoming many of our students into our Sixth Form to continue their studies with us.

    Overall, results have been good for students of all abilities. Students continue to make progress above the national average and we have seen strong results in English, Maths and Science.

    Students have worked hard for these results and they have benefitted from first class teaching and strong pastoral support. I am really pleased for students and staff and wish all our students the very best of luck in the next steps in their education and careers.

Ben Coleman, Director of Sixth Form, added: “It is fantastic to have so many of our year 11 students coming to join us in the Sixth Form, as well as those coming to us from other schools in the region.
“After last week’s outstanding A level results we look forward to working with the new year 12 cohort to help them achieve great things in their A level studies.”
